Visualize your workflow data, in one place. From commit to deploy. With Gitalytics you can be data-driven using stats that developers care about.

Git analytics launched on Product Hunt on June 3rd, 2019 and earned 127 upvotes and 6 comments, placing #8 on the daily leaderboard. Visualize your workflow data, in one place. From commit to deploy. With Gitalytics you can be data-driven using stats that developers care about.

Who hunted Git analytics?

Git analytics was hunted by Julien Ricard. A “hunter” on Product Hunt is the community member who submits a product to the platform — uploading the images, the link, and tagging the makers behind it. Hunters typically write the first comment explaining why a product is worth attention, and their followers are notified the moment they post. Around 79% of featured launches on Product Hunt are self-hunted by their makers, but a well-known hunter still acts as a signal of quality to the rest of the community.
